Navigating Political Uncertainty

This chapter explores the shifting dynamics of UK politics following the Conservative victory in 2019, focusing on Labour's struggle to adapt amid economic challenges. It highlights key issues affecting voter sentiment and discusses the potential rise of the Reform party in certain regions. The narrative emphasizes the complexities of party strategies within a fragmented electoral system and the impact of voter discontent on emerging political forces.
